What period products can I use?

There are a variety of products available to use when you have your period, which either absorb or collect the blood. Tampons and pads absorb blood while menstrual cups collect blood. Tampons are small tubes that are placed inside the vagina, which act as a type of stopper to absorb the blood. Pads are stuck onto your underwear and absorb the blood too. You get reusable and disposable pads. The menstrual cup is a small bowl-shaped device that fits snugly inside your vagina and collects the blood. They are usually reusable – you simply empty them, wash, and use again.

The walls of your vagina hold the menstrual cups and tampons in place, so you can hardly feel them and they don’t move around either.
